Abstract

The research results of the features of the use of the V-model in the development and evaluation of the quality of software of measuring instruments (MI) were presented. The analysis of the possibility of using a cascade software development strategy and its application to assessing the quality of the software being developed was carried out. It is difficult to implement a classical cascade model in its pure form, therefore, variants of such a model with feedback between its separate stages was developed. The disadvantages and advantages of the V-model, which supports the cascade strategy of one-time execution of software development stages, are considered. The main purpose of the V-model is to provide planning testing software in the early stages of its development. V-model is aimed at simplifying the understanding of the complexity of software development. It is used to determine a single procedure for developing software, hardware and user interface. To reduce the shortcomings of the cascade strategy, a number of modifications of the V-model have been developed due to the type of feedback that provides the ability to modify the results of the previous stages of development. Specific guidelines and recommendations of international and regional organizations for legal metrology have been used to determine the components for quality assessment of MI software. The tasks of developing a MI software on the left side of the letter V begin with the definition of requirements to the MI itself, then to the MI software, and only then as a traditional software development. The V-model of the development and evaluation of the MI software quality is proposed, which allows you to adapt this model to a particular MI at the very beginning of the software development. It takes into account all the specific components of software testing for the MI. The degree of verification of the components of the MI software depends on the risk classes that are assigned to the software, depending on the MI for which it is created. The V-model of development and quality assessment of software of MI which takes into account all the specific components of the test are presented.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call